How to Find the Best Walking Treadmill Under Desks

Under desk treadmills, you can easily incorporate vigorous workouts in your working day. Before purchasing one, carefully review the dimensions to ensure it will fit under your desk.

Since under-desk models aren't as robust as fitness treadmills, they typically have lower weight limits.

Capacity of Weight

If you're considering an under-desk treadmill, it's important to know the capacity of its weight prior to making a purchase. The majority of under-desk treadmills can support 265 pounds, which is adequate for most people. If you are heavier or intend to use the treadmill for extended periods of time it is recommended to look into a treadmill with a more weight capacity.

In addition to the weight limits, it's worth considering the speed range of the top treadmills for walking that are under desks. While most under-desk models can only go up to 4 miles per hour, this is fast enough for most people to keep up with an average pace of walking while working. Most treadmills that are under desks we've tested have operating noise levels of less than 34 decibels, which is very quiet for a treadmill that is designed to be a workout machine.

Many of the under-desk treadmills we've looked at have various features, including remote control operation and smartphone app compatibility. These extras can make your treadmill more enjoyable to use. Some even have built-in displays on the pad that allow you to view your progress without looking at the remote.

The belt's size is another aspect to consider when purchasing an under-desk treadmill. A belt that is larger will allow you more room for movement and prevent you from feeling cramped as you work. Under-desk treadmills tend to be smaller and lighter than traditional treadmills, which could make them more portable and easier to move around. Many have wheels that make it easy to place them behind couches or under desks when they are not in use.

When shopping for a new under desk treadmill be sure to be sure to check the maximum speed as well as the motor power the treadmill can handle. Under-desk treadmills that are made for walking only, have motors that are usually less powerful than those of larger treadmills made for running. However, you need to make sure that the treadmill you choose can support your weight and keep pace with your walking speed.

Most under-desk treadmills can run at the maximum speed of four miles per hour, which will be plenty for most people to fit in a couple of moderate cardio exercises at work without taking too much time away from other tasks. When you're looking for a treadmill underneath desks, pay close attention to the size and width of the belt. A wider belt will offer more real estate for comfortable walking, while a narrower belt may feel tight. Also, take into consideration the noise level of the device, particularly when you'll be using it during working hours. Noise can be distracting making it difficult to focus on your work. You'll need to choose an item with a low level of noise.

A lot of under-desk models are a bit loud and are therefore not suitable for spaces that are shared.
